How much oil for 93 CR 125 forks?

Ok fokes, I am totally new to suspension and I am going to be changing the fork oil and seals in my 1993 CR 125 this weekend. Can anyone tell me how many CCs or MMs or whatever needs to go in each tube? I would rather not spend $40 on a manual for this one question.

Anyone? With the forks totally compressed and the spring removed, I need to know how much distance there should be from the oil level to the top of the forks. At least a baseline to start with so I can to tweek them?
Thanks
Posted by: Vic---------------------
110mm should put you in the ballpark.
Posted by: bchitwood73---------------------
Well I took out all the Oil from my forks last night and only got maybe a 1/2 quart from both. Does that seem right, I mean I knew they were leaking a little but there should have been WAY more then that in there.
So when I put everything back together I want to first leave out the springs, and then compress the forks so they are totally colapsed and then fill them to the point where there is about 110mm of space from the oil itself to the top of the fork where the valve threads on correct? Should I go all the way to the rim of the tube or just to where the cap would sit if it were installed?
Posted by: Vic---------------------
Measure to the top of the fork tube.
